【题目】Dear Sally,

Please take these things to your brother Bob: his dictionary, pen, notebook, keys, and a baseball. The dictionary is on the bed. The pen is in the pencil box. I put the pencil box on the sofa. The notebook is on the desk. The keys are on the dresser. The baseball is under the bed. Thanks.

Grandma

【题目】 Hobbies should be an important part of everyone's life. Today, we’re going to talk about one of the oldest and most popular hobbies: collecting. Want to start your own collection? Here are the ways.

__________

First, you have to decide what you’re going to collect. It’s okay to pick something that simply interests you. If you love reading, books are a great choice.

__________

You need to start with usual and cheap pieces, and they will build your collection’s foundation (基础). As you’re doing your homework (see below), you’ll come to know those pieces. Think of it like a pyramid(金字塔)—- there has to be a foundation before you can move up into better pieces.

__________

Before collecting, do some research on what you’re collecting. Of course there are collectors like you. So get on the website, ask them questions and find out where to start.

__________

It’s easy for many starters to spend a lot of money, end up with many things, and finally lose interest. The beauty of having a collection is that it should be something you can make into a “career—beginning as a young man and continuing through retirement (退休)”. Make it a goal to add just a few pieces to your collection per year.
